BA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

2,038 of the 5,651 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Boeing (BA)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$66.9B — up 39% from $48B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 413 funds opened new BA positions and 81 closed out — a net gain of 332 holders — while 732 added to existing stakes and 715 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Newport Trust Company, adding an estimated $2.77B. The largest seller was D.E. Shaw & Co, cutting an estimated $530M.
